About the position

LifeCircles PACE delivers primary care, palliative care, and end-of-life care for patients 55 and older. The RN Clinical Coordinator primary work setting is an outpatient clinic with care also provided in patient's homes and facilities. This position is perfect for the RN who wants to be patient-centered, creative, autonomous, and collaborative in their approach to healthcare.

Responsibilities

  • Work closely with other RNs, APPs, and MAs in a well-supported, team-based environment
  • Participate in regular interdisciplinary team meetings
  • Complete RN health assessments and participate in team-based care planning
  • Provide care in various settings (outpatient clinic, patient's homes, Assisted Living Facilities, and Skilled Nursing Facilities)
  • Wound care and other skilled nursing tasks
  • Assess acute needs and illnesses
  • Patient and care giver education
  • Case management and clinical coordination

Requirements

  • RN-Nursing Diploma or Degree from accredited School of Nursing or University
  • Current license to practice as a Registered Nurse (RN) in the state of Michigan
